The head of the Main Intelligence Directorate of the Ukrainian Defense Ministry, Kirill Budanov, said that the Ukrainian side is negotiating with Russia on the exchange of prisoners of war in the “all for all” format, reports RBC Ukraine.
Budanov noted that currently the parties are getting closer to implementing the relevant agreements.
Ukraine has returned more than 2,200 troops so far, he added.
Earlier, the Russian Defense Ministry reported that 106 soldiers had returned to their homeland as a result of the prisoner of war exchange with Ukraine.
In addition, Igor Kimakovsky, adviser to the acting head of the DPR, reported that Ukrainian servicemen began to arrive en masse in the Avdiivka region.
